Spring is the top season of the year for consumer spending at food and beverage shops across the Miami area, according to data on local business transactions from Womply, a software provider that also helps companies find free business advertising. Daily spending at Miami-area food and beverage shops grew to $152,290 for the metro area in the spring of last year, 7% higher than the average for the rest of the year.

1. Marky's

Photo: Emily H./Yelp

First on the list is Marky's. Located at 687 N.E. 79th St., the grocery store and gourmet food spot is the highest-rated grocery store in Miami, boasting 4.5 stars out of 91 reviews on Yelp.

2. Oriental Bakery & Grocery Co.

Photo: Keith P./Yelp

Next is Coral Way's Oriental Bakery & Grocery Co., situated at 1760 S.W. Third Ave. With 4.5 stars out of 90 reviews on Yelp, the bakery, grocery store and Middle Eastern spot has proved to be a local favorite.

3. Whole Foods MarketĀ 

Photo: Mark D./Yelp

Downtown's Whole Foods Market, a location of the chain located at 299 S.E. Third Ave., is another top choice, with Yelpers giving the grocery store four stars out of 199 reviews.

4. Milam's Market

Photo: Juan F./Yelp

Milam's Market, a grocery store, is another go-to, with four stars out of 93 Yelp reviews. Head over to 2969 McDonald St. to see for yourself.
